English as a Second Language (ESL)

BPS Adult Education offers FREE ESL classes for English Language Learners (ELLs) who need to develop skills in reading, writing, listening and speaking. Students from all countries and at all skills levels are welcome to enroll.
Classes range from beginning literacy through advanced level ESL classes that focus on vocabulary building, conversation practice and comprehension skills.
All learners 17 and older are welcome.
Classrooms are located throughout the City of Buffalo with Distance Education and Virtual options available to those who qualify. Classes are also held in the morning, afternoon, or evening so you can find a class that fits into your schedule!
All students must attend a mandatory orientation to begin classes with Adult Education. The orientation takes place at the Adult Learning Center, 389 Virginia Street, Buffalo NY 14202. If you are signing up and qualify for distance education or virtual classes, this will be one of the only times you have to go in person.

Meet Our Students from Around the World!

Faramarz (Afghanistan) has been in Buffalo about 4 months. He works at BJ's and is hoping to improve his English enough to be promoted to a higher-paying position.

Marie (Hati) wants to improve her English fluency to be able to work in an office setting.

This is Yordania and Yordano (Venezuela) her son, both students at the ALC. Yordania is the head of household and wants to learn English quickly so that she can take care of her family's needs. Yordano is enjoying experiencing a new culture and the socialization that our class provides.

Halyna (Ukraine) is taking English classes to improve her grammar and fluency so she can communicate with more confidence in the community and find employment in the future.
